Q: My speed sensor on my Sable is going out an I tried to find it the other morning to replace it bu I couldn't find it. All someone old me is that it is by my transmission. Thanks to all answers and God Bless

A: There is a output shaft speed sensor on the output shaft housing of the transmission on the passenger's side of the car, down behind the engine, and there is a turbine speed sensor on the body of the transmission over on the driver's side.
